Adding an OLE object to a report
To add an OLE object to a report, you begin by specifying where you want the
OLE object and opening the Insert Object dialog box so you can define the
OLE object.
Adding an ActiveX control
Adding an ActiveX control to a report is similar to adding an OLE object. Both
exist within the report with other controls, such as columns, computed fields,
and text controls. Use the following procedure whether you want to add an
OLE object or an ActiveX control to an existing report.
❖ To place an OLE object in a report:
1 Open the report that will contain the OLE object.
2 Select Insert>Control>OLE Object from the menu bar, or from the toolbar,
click the Object drop-down arrow and select the OLE button (not OLE
Database Blob).
3 Click where you want to place the OLE object.
InfoMaker displays the Insert Object dialog box.
